#2e8d94 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2e8d94 is composed of 18% red, 55.3%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.9% cyan, 4.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 184.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 38%. #2e8d94 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#001b29.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#2e8d94

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d0d is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e8d94

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b6667 is the less saturated color, while #01b4c1 is the most saturated one.
